To your point about the art style, all the assets are brand new. This isn't just reusing the old SNES or Mega Drive games sprites, if you go and compare them side by side the difference is night and day. There is a lot going on here that just simply wasn't possible on the old 16-bit home consoles. So while I do agree the cutscenes should have been in the same art style, to be able to swap between them would need two teams or artists to essentially make copies of everything. TMNT had cartoon scenes as well but it's pixel art is a lot larger with a more "cutesy" vibe. Rita's Rewind is using a lot smaller sprites which means the details are harder to define and as a result can't match the animated scenes as well. All in all I think Shredders Revenge does have a better aesthetic but in motion when you're playing the game I don't think it will really be something you notice
